Special Features
Special features include a one, two, three, four, and five coin bet level that can be played with different coin size ranges. Coin size ranges from 0.10, increasing up to 2.25, which would make a maximum wager of 12.50, which is unusual in itself. With a the maximum prize on a Royal Flush set at 4000 coins there are many more of these games that can be played on as little as 5.00 for the opportunity to win the same top prize. It pays to bear in mind that the top prize can only be won when wagering with a maximum bet.
It offers an automatic “Hold” feature which helps the player make the correct decision according to best strategy. In other words, the game automatically teaches us what it is looking for in terms of winning combinations. Winning combinations are made up of traditional poker hands such as Royal Flush as we mentioned, Straight Flush, Four of a Kind and so on, with the lowest winning combination being Jacks or Better. This is not unusual in video poker, as Jacks or Better have nearly always paid, whereas these are not generally winning hands in a traditional poker game.
Additional to being able to choose the amount of coins played, and choose the coin amount, this version unusually also offers a bet history, the ability to switch off sound, and whether or not it is played in high or low quality.
Bonus Features
Often online video poker games offer us a gamble option after winning. Whether these are “bonus” features or not is debatable. Basically a Hi-Lo or Double or Nothing game is made available after a winning hand. This version of All American Video Poker from 1 x 2 Gaming has not made a gamble option available, but we don’t believe that this is a huge loss.
